博主首页
上一页 1 2 3 4 5 6 ··· 47 下一页
摘要: 父组件内定义插槽具体内容 <table-data> <!-- 两种方式,下面是简写 <template v-slot:supplierOrderNo="data" >--> <template #supplierOrderNo="data" > {{ data.data}} </template> 阅读全文
posted @ 2025-01-17 10:23 笑~笑 阅读(49) 评论(0) 推荐(0) 编辑
摘要: methods:{ dictByItem: function(item, row) { let dictElement = this.dict[item.dictName]; let filter = dictElement.filter(i => i.value row[item.prop] + 阅读全文
posted @ 2025-01-16 18:25 笑~笑 阅读(4) 评论(0) 推荐(0) 编辑
摘要: <el-table-column label="保司提交资料报文" prop="insuranceSubmitData" show-overflow-tooltip /> 将show-overflow-tooltip改为动态绑定此处是为了将表格渲染封装成通用组件 <template v-for="i 阅读全文
posted @ 2025-01-16 15:40 笑~笑 阅读(9) 评论(0) 推荐(0) 编辑
摘要: 多个组件引入同一个js文件,实例化对象,数据不会错乱,再引入相同的组件,例如每个页面都需要引入到一个分页组件,然后分页组件需要获取各自父组件中的实例对象 通过 this.$parent 即可获取到父组件中的数据 所以在使用子组件时可以不用在组件上传入数据 公共js文件 function data1( 阅读全文
posted @ 2025-01-16 11:42 笑~笑 阅读(21) 评论(0) 推荐(0) 编辑
摘要: 代码复用,可以使用引入的组件内的数据以及方法 使用 Mixins 的步骤 定义 Mixin: 创建一个包含共享选项的对象。例如,定义一个 myMixin.js 文件: // myMixin.js export default { data() { return { mixinData: 'This 阅读全文
posted @ 2025-01-15 16:06 笑~笑 阅读(12) 评论(0) 推荐(0) 编辑
摘要: 如果将方法定义在methods里 就可以在模块中使用该方法 test1方法无法正常使用 test2方法可以使用 阅读全文
posted @ 2025-01-15 15:57 笑~笑 阅读(2) 评论(0) 推荐(0) 编辑
摘要: Vue2 存在两种监听方式,分别是简单监听和复杂监听 简单监听:监听的是一个回调函数,当监听的值发生改变时,才会执行监听动作。 <template> <h2>当前求和值为:{{ sum }}</h2> <button @click="sum++">点击加1</button> </template> 阅读全文
posted @ 2025-01-15 11:33 笑~笑 阅读(106) 评论(0) 推荐(0) 编辑
摘要: beforeCreate:在这里加loading(页面加载的时候我想要做的事情) created:在这里结束loading,还可以做一些初始数据的获取 beforeMount:载入前(已经完成了data和el数据初始化),但是页面中的内容还是vue的占位符,data中的数据是没有被挂载到dom节点中 阅读全文
posted @ 2025-01-15 11:27 笑~笑 阅读(6) 评论(0) 推荐(0) 编辑
摘要: 在javascript中,使用import语句导入模块时,加上花括号{}与不加的区别在于: 1.不加花括号 导入整个模块对象。 例如: import axios from 'axios' 会导入整个axios模块,可以通过axios.get()等方法来使用它。 2.加上花括号 只导入模块中的指定变量 阅读全文
posted @ 2025-01-13 16:35 笑~笑 阅读(99) 评论(0) 推荐(0) 编辑
摘要: 打开项目设置,重新添加modules 选择对应的根目录就可以了 阅读全文
posted @ 2025-01-13 10:33 笑~笑 阅读(96)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 ··· 47 下一页
点击右上角即可分享
微信分享提示